Main functions
* Coordinate with Product Management and R&D the cryptographic keys and digital certificates necessary to secure the group’s products and solutions.
* Be responsible for the correct exchange and processing of keys and certificates with customers and internal departments.
* Ensure that systems are adapted and can manage keys and certificates according to Payment Card Industry (PCI), GSMA, ISO27001 and other security frameworks.
* Conduct key management trainings when necessary.
* Be actively involved in internal and external security audits to demonstrate the Key Management process.
